Our second "minisode" focuses on the events that happened in Runnymede, England in 1216, when King John of England sealed a deal with his rebellious barons to bring some peace to his kingdom.

80 Days is a podcast dedicated to exploring little-known countries, territories settlements and cities around the world. We're part history podcast, part geography podcast and part ramble. Each episode, we'll land in a new locale and spend some time discussing the history, geography, culture, sport, religion, industry, pastimes and music of our new location.
